San Jacinto County real estate Market Report.

Information and statistics on the latest trends in the San Jacinto County real estate market, updated for April 2026. *

San Jacinto County is behaving like a classic buyer’s market right now, with 190 homes for sale and 9.5 months of supply. Buyers have time to shop, as the median home spends 137 days on the market. Fewer deals are moving to contract, with only 25 pending sales in the latest month.

Prices are reacting in mixed ways. The typical home value has surged to about $371,000, up 83.71% over the past year, and well above the Texas average of roughly $342,400. At the same time, the median list price sits lower at $300,000, even after an 18.39% monthly jump. Many sellers are adjusting expectations, with about 31% of listings seeing a price drop and homes selling for about 95% of list price on average.

New listing activity is slightly softer than last year, with 49 new listings and a 5.77% annual decline, while pending sales have fallen more sharply, down about 40%. Looking ahead to April 2026, projections point to a typical home value near $434,000, a median list price around $323,300, and inventory edging up to about 195 homes. With Texas overall carrying roughly 126,046 listings, local buyers in San Jacinto County have options and negotiating power, while sellers must price carefully to stand out. Learn more about what San Jacinto County has to offer.

San Jacinto County offers residents a welcoming, close-knit community with abundant outdoor recreation, scenic natural areas, and reliable local services that support families and small businesses.

San Jacinto County offers a quieter, more woodsy lifestyle than nearby Houston or Montgomery County, while still keeping regional jobs, medical care, and shopping within reach. Centered around Coldspring and the Lake Livingston area, the county appeals to residents who value open space, water access, and a strong sense of community.

Lake Livingston is the star attraction, with boating, fishing, and lakeside cabins drawing full‑time residents and weekenders alike. Lake Livingston State Park adds hiking trails, campgrounds, and playgrounds, and the nearby Double Lake Recreation Area in the Sam Houston National Forest offers shaded picnic spots and mountain bike loops. In town, Coldspring-Oakhurst CISD schools and local events like trades days and holiday festivals keep families connected.

Smaller communities, including Point Blank and Shepherd, have a local identity shaped by feed stores, family-owned restaurants, and long-running churches. The county library system, anchored by the Shepherd Public Library, supports year‑round programming and internet access, which matters for remote workers choosing a rural address.
